Detailed Cautionary announcement                                                
Introduction                                                                    
Further to the cautionary announcements published by Wesizwe, the last  one     
appearing on 22 April 2010, Wesizwe is pleased to announce that the Company     
has signed a term sheet ("Term Sheet") with Jinchuan Group Limited ("JNMC")     
and  China-Africa Development Fund ("CADFund")  ("the Parties"), which sets     
out  a  proposal  by  JNMC and CADFund to provide the Company,  subject  to     
certain  conditions  precedent set out in the  Term  Sheet,  with  a  total     
financing solution for the development of the Company`s core Frischgewaagd-     
Ledig Project ("the Project") ("the Proposed Transaction").   The terms and     
conditions  set  out in the Term Sheet are to be formalised  in  a  set  of     
definitive  transaction  agreements ("Transaction  Documents"),  which  are     
currently being negotiated by the Parties. This announcement summarises the     
key terms and conditions contained in the Term Sheet.                           
Neither  the Term Sheet nor this announcement constitutes a firm  intention     
on the part of JNMC and CADFund to make an offer to shareholders of Wesizwe     
for  the  purposes  of  the Securities Regulation  Code  on  Takeovers  and     
Mergers.                                                                        
Details of the Proposed Transaction                                             
The Proposed Transaction will, if successfully concluded, comprise of:          
- an  equity component of US$227 million whereby JNMC and CADFund (or a new     
entity  to  be  jointly  owned by JNMC and CADFund)  will  subscribe  for      
 829,884,460 new ordinary shares, which will constitute 51% of  the  fully      
 diluted  issued  share capital of Wesizwe upon closing  of  the  Proposed      
 Transaction,  for  an aggregate subscription price of  US$227.53  million      
("the  Equity  Component"). This will equate to a subscription  price  of      
 R2.07 per Wesizwe share at an exchange rate of US$/ZAR 7.55;                   
- a  debt  component of US$650 million pursuant to which JNMC  and  CADFund     
 have  secured a Letter of Commitment from the China Development Bank  for      
the  provision  of a US$650 million project finance facility  ("the  Debt      
 Component") to the Company; and                                                
- a  financial  guarantee / shareholder loan commitment pursuant  to  which     
 JNMC  shall provide any funding shortfall needed in order for the Project      
to  reach full production via a shareholders loan to Wesizwe on the  same      
 commercial terms as the Debt Component.                                        
JNMC  and  Wesizwe  have  agreed that JNMC will purchase  all  of  the  PGM     
concentrate  from  the  Project through a long term off-take  agreement  on     
terms  and  conditions still to be agreed between Wesizwe and  JNMC,  which     
terms and conditions will include pricing mechanisms consistent with market     
practice and timely payment provisions.                                         
Rationale for the Proposed Transaction                                          
Wesizwe believes that the Proposed Transaction represents both a compelling     
value  and  strategic  proposition for shareholders for,  inter  alia,  the     
following reasons:                                                              
-    It will provide shareholders with a total financing solution of US$877     
million  (R6.6  billion)  (consisting of a  combination  of  debt  and      
    equity) for the development of the Project. This will:                      
    - ensure  that  that there will be no further equity dilution  through      
      the Project`s construction phase;                                         
- allow  shareholders to retain exposure to one of  the  best  quality      
      undeveloped PGM projects in South Africa; and                             
    - provide  shareholders  with an excellent value  proposition  in  the      
      current global uncertainty.                                               
- With  the  introduction  of  JNMC, Wesizwe  will  secure  an  experienced     
 mining, financial  and technical partner;                                      
- The  debt  funding  will  be  secured at globally  competitive  financing     
 rates;                                                                         
- Furthermore,  the provision of financial guarantees by JNMC will  enhance     
 the  certainty  that  shareholders will not be called  upon  for  further      
 funding as regards the development of the Project; and                         
- It  will  provide  Wesizwe with the financial  muscle  to  enable  it  to     
examine future growth opportunities.                                           
Conditions precedent to the Proposed Transaction                                
The Proposed Transaction is subject to approval by inter alia the Board  of     
Directors of each of the Parties respectively.                                  
The  Proposed  Transaction will further be subject  to  the  fulfilment  of     
conditions  precedent which are customary for transactions of this  nature.     
Such conditions precedent include inter alia:                                   
 - The   Proposed   Transaction  being  approved,  inter  alia,   by   the      
shareholders of Wesizwe;                                                    
 - The  Parties  obtaining all approvals necessary for the  implementation      
    of  the  Proposed Transaction from relevant regulatory authorities  in      
    South Africa and China respectively;                                        
- The  shareholders  of Wesizwe have in general meeting waived  JNMC  and      
    CADFund`s  obligation to make a mandatory offer  for  all  the  issued      
    shares  of  Wesizwe held by the other shareholders  in  terms  of  the      
    Securities  Regulation  Code and Rules of  the  Securities  Regulation      
Panel; and                                                                  
 - The  Securities Regulation Panel of South Africa has agreed to dispense      
    with the requirement for JNMC/CADFund to make the mandatory offer.          
Information on JNMC and CADFund                                                 
JNMC                                                                            
 - JNMC  is  a Chinese state owned company under the jurisdiction  of  the      
    Peoples  Government of the Gansu Province, Peoples Republic  of  China      
    ("China").                                                                  
- JNMC  is  the  largest producer of nickel and PGM`s in  China  and  the      
    largest producer of refined copper in Northern China.                       
 - JNMC  has  an  integrated business in non-ferrous metals  from  mining,      
    refining  and  marketing to project engineering and  mining  equipment      
manufacturing.                                                              
 - JNMC  has  over the last few years been actively involved in investment      
    projects outside of China.                                                  
CADFund                                                                         
- Established  on  June 26th, 2007, the CADFund is the  first  investment      
    fund in China focusing on investments in Africa.
